
60,000+ Downloads: Lessons Learned in Open-Source Development
Lessons learned from building an Open-Source Javascript library from scratch.
Browse my collection of articles on frontend development, performance optimization, and web technologies.
Lessons learned from building an Open-Source Javascript library from scratch.
2 quick tips you can use when working with the output from the JS console.
How to use the ussd-router utility to manage USSD routing headaches.
How to protect yourself from clickjacking attacks.
Explore my collection of projects focused on frontend development, performance optimization, and developer tools.
An AI-driven commercial real estate solution for Manhattan, NYC featuring Gen AI agents, RAG, vector databases, geofencing maps, and real-time data processing.
A Node.js library for creating bots and sending/receiving messages using the Whatsapp Cloud API.
A web app for discovering all events happening daily in Kenya. Built from the ground up in React, PostgreSQL, and GraphQL.
This React app loads live data from Google Sheets and creates a dashboard with highly interactive and customizable charts, allowing users to visualize the data.
This research paper creates a breast cancer predictive system using machine learning, comparing datasets from 1992 and 1995. It evaluates Logistic Regression, SVM, and Bayesian Regression models to show the impact of data quality on prediction accuracy.
Unofficial Typescript version of the Africa's Talking SDK.
Browse my collection of talks, workshops, and conference presentations on frontend development, performance optimization, and API integrations.